Fodor's Review:
Five blocks from the Marina, this four-story 1924 building feels a little like a B&B but is priced like a motel. English country-style rooms with vivid floral wallpaper and bedspreads are simply appointed with queen-size two-poster beds, private baths, small pinewood writing desks, and armoires. Some rooms have daybeds appropriate for a small child. The rooms facing Octavia and Lombard streets have bay windows with window seats, but they are noisier than the inside rooms. A simple continental breakfast is served in the central sitting room.
